Trousseau packing is an important part of preparing and presenting a bride's wedding belongings. Sarees, jewellery, accessories, cosmetics, gifts and other personal items can be organised into carefully selected boxes and packages to create a neat and attractive bridal presentation.

A well-planned bridal trousseau can make it easier to identify important items while also adding a traditional and elegant element to wedding preparations. From saree boxes to jewellery organisers, each component can be selected according to the bride's requirements, family traditions and overall wedding styling.

Trousseau packing can be simple and practical or detailed and decorative, depending on the scale of the wedding and the family's preferences.

Understanding Bridal Trousseau Packing

A bridal trousseau is a collection of clothing, accessories, jewellery and personal items prepared for the bride around her wedding.

Packing these items systematically helps protect them and makes them easier to organise.

The presentation can also be designed to make the trousseau visually appealing when it is displayed during wedding preparations or family ceremonies.

Saree Packing for the Bride

Bridal sarees can be packed according to the order in which they will be worn.

Wedding ceremony sarees, reception sarees and other outfits can be grouped separately.

This makes it easier for the bride and family members to locate the required outfit during busy wedding schedules.

Jewellery Organization

Jewellery is one of the most important parts of a bridal trousseau.

Necklaces, earrings, bangles, rings and other accessories should be organised separately to reduce tangling and make selection easier.

Individual pouches, compartments or jewellery boxes can be used according to the type of jewellery.

Bridal Jewellery Boxes

A dedicated jewellery box can provide separate spaces for different accessories.

Necklaces can be kept away from smaller pieces, while earrings and rings can be placed in individual compartments.

The box should be secure and suitable for transporting valuable jewellery.

South Indian Bridal Trousseau

South Indian weddings often involve multiple silk sarees, jewellery pieces and traditional accessories.

A well-organised trousseau can separate these items by ceremony and function.

The presentation can coordinate with traditional wedding elements such as Seer Varisai and family gifting.

Saree and Jewellery Coordination

Pairing jewellery with the saree it will be worn with can make wedding-day preparation easier.

Each set can be packed together or assigned a clear identification label.

This approach helps reduce the time needed to assemble the bride's complete look for each ceremony.

Ceremony-Wise Packing

The trousseau can be divided according to the wedding schedule.

Separate sections can be created for engagement, Mehndi, wedding ceremony, reception and post-wedding events where applicable.

This keeps each day's clothing and accessories ready for use.

Planning the Packing Process

Trousseau packing should ideally begin after the bride's major clothing and accessory selections have been finalised.

Items can then be grouped, labelled and packed according to the wedding schedule.

A final inventory check can help ensure that important items are not overlooked.
